Valerie Joy Rutter née Valerie Harrison (born 1954), is a female former athlete who competed for England.
Rutter became the 1974 National champion (under her maiden name of Harrison) after winning the British AAA high jump championship.
[1] She represented England in the high jump event, at the 1974 British Commonwealth Games in Christchurch, New Zealand.
[2][3] Four years later she represented England again in the high jump event, at the 1978 Commonwealth Games in Edmonton, Alberta, Canada.
